Transaction 150023e5d4aa74b66629fded56c7876c2ab73522f1fe3d5bd234bd77833bc915

1 Input
2 Outputs
  • 150023e5d4aa74b66629fded56c7876c2ab73522f1fe3d5bd234bd77833bc915:0
  • value  264511
    address  12jYkp45QteGV4Q2zufHRWbL7LQZWjrj1h
  • 150023e5d4aa74b66629fded56c7876c2ab73522f1fe3d5bd234bd77833bc915:1
  • value  197174412
    address  17Dw3zpVG35wiXkwHbrjtBsimTuBMk8z2B